Panda Categorical achieves the tenderness of its beef as a result of a combination of techniques, which includes velveting and marinating. Velveting is a popular Chinese cooking system in which meat is coated in a mix of cornstarch, egg whites, and sometimes rice wine prior to cooking.

Silgochu basically signifies "thread pepper", and refers to purple chili peppers that have been dried and Reduce into slivers. Silgochu resembles saffron in visual appearance, which is made use of as attractive garnish.

Avoid the Fridge Why it Matters: Though the fridge might sound just like a superior spot to keep spices great, it in fact introduces humidity that can make paprika clump and degrade. Paprika does ideal at space temperature wherever it stays dry.
Like most spices, retail store containers in the great, dry location.
